Arriving a few minutes after Mad Sweet Pangs finished up their opening set, I could not help feel disappointed I missed them. This was a special night for me and there was no room for negative vibes. Tonight was about connecting with friends made at the birth of this journey. I walked through the doorways of The Recher Theater, the memories and energy were clear as day as they were back in October. This building was about to be delivered with a package that it may not have seen since Pgroove's last performance.

Pgroove wasted no time displaying their style of unique rock that makes them Pgroove. If you have not been to a Pgroove show, it is like seeing Pink Floyd on on a quasi mind trip. The tones are rich, decisive and smooth. The sound is crystal clear, boastering a 5.1 concert surround sound system. Tones so clear, that when you close your eyes and move to the music a kaleidescope bursts with life out of the darkness of your mind. The beauty of Pgroove is that they incorporate Electronic into Rock into a style their fans label as "trance arena rock". I am not exactly sure what trance arena rock is, maybe some mutant hybrid jam, but I know I can get down to it.

altAs they opened with No Decorations, my body was carried with the ebb and flow of the music. The life that emerge out of the darkness transformed before my eyes, here was the beauty of Cabulo-Monstrosity. The tranquility of Cabulo-Monstrosity put my body into a state where it floated across the room in a weightless like demeanor as I danced. As I closed my eyes, the greenery grew with a pastel hue taking on the shape of a paisley pattern in my mind. Brock's guitar carried me into another state of consciousness during Mayday. Recovered by the drums, the beat of ancients and our tribal nature were clear as day as they followed up with The Golden Path. It was during the second set that it became clear we were in for a block of energy above the first set. The band ripped into a Praise You, a Fatboy Slim cover, that let you know you were exactly where you needed to be tonight. The point of exhilaration in the second set peaked when the band laid out Macumba>Wu Tang Clan Ain't Nuthin' To Fuck With>Macumba. Feeling the beat of the band, the energy of the crowd, they chanted Pgroove for one more. The band heeded the call of the fans and delivered an emotion filled Robotz Waltz that settled you back into reality as the night came to a close.

Unique in it's sound, energy that carries you into the night, Pgroove is one show you don't want to miss.
